Cancer's Deepest Fears: What Terrifies the Crab

Cancer's deepest fear is abandonment. Cancer fears being left, rejected, and emotionally homeless. Their entire identity is built around belonging, and the prospect of being cast out is devastating.

The Core Fears

  • Being abandoned by the people they love most
  • Rejection after showing their vulnerable true self
  • Their family falling apart or their home being destroyed
  • Being forgotten or replaced by someone better
  • Emotional betrayal — having their trust weaponized against them

How These Fears Show Up

You may not consciously recognize these fears because they often disguise themselves as preferences, standards, or personality traits. Fear of abandonment becomes clinginess. Fear of failure becomes workaholism. Fear of meaninglessness becomes constant seeking. The fear hides inside the behavior.

Working Through the Fear

  • Name the fear specifically — vague anxiety is harder to address than a specific identified fear
  • Notice when the fear is driving your decisions rather than your values
  • Build evidence against the fear by taking small risks in the direction it warns you away from
  • Seek support from people who understand your sign's particular vulnerability
